Skip to content

Commit 4abec57

Browse files
committed
refactor: raw check
1 parent 32f65d6 commit 4abec57

File tree

5 files changed

+8
-8
lines changed

5 files changed

+8
-8
lines changed

package-lock.json

Lines changed: 2 additions & 2 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

src/components/file.vue

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-49,7 +49,7 @@
4949
</template>
5050

5151
<script>
52-
import { computed, ref, watch, onMounted, onUnmounted, getCurrentInstance } from 'vue'
52+
import { computed, ref, toRaw, watch, onMounted, onUnmounted, getCurrentInstance } from 'vue'
5353
import Uploader from 'simple-uploader.js'
5454
import { secondsToStr } from '../common/utils'
5555
import events from '../common/file-events'
@@ -188,7 +188,7 @@ export default {
188188
const rootFile = args[0]
189189
const file = args[1]
190190
const target = props.list ? rootFile : file
191-
if (JSON.stringify(props.file) === JSON.stringify(target)) {
191+
if (toRaw(props.file) === toRaw(target)) {
192192
if (props.list && event === 'fileSuccess') {
193193
processResponse(args[2])
194194
return

src/components/files.vue

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@
1111
</template>
1212

1313
<script>
14-
import { inject, ref, watch } from 'vue'
14+
import { inject } from 'vue'
1515
import UploaderFile from './file.vue'
1616
1717
const COMPONENT_NAME = 'uploader-files'

src/components/list.vue

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@
1111
</template>
1212

1313
<script>
14-
import { inject, ref, watch } from 'vue'
14+
import { inject } from 'vue'
1515
import UploaderFile from './file.vue'
1616
1717
const COMPONENT_NAME = 'uploader-list'

src/components/uploader.vue

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-79,11 +79,11 @@
7979
return false
8080
}
8181
}
82-
const fileRemoved = (fi) => {
82+
const fileRemoved = () => {
8383
files.value = uploader.files
8484
fileList.value = uploader.fileList
8585
}
86-
const filesSubmitted = (fi, flist) => {
86+
const filesSubmitted = () => {
8787
files.value = uploader.files
8888
fileList.value = uploader.fileList
8989
if (props.autoStart) {

0 commit comments

Comments
 (0)